If the Tilecrate image cache starts eating memory again (you'll see the worker RSS climb past 2 GB within an hour), it's almost always a plugin holding decoded bitmaps past the eviction callback. Quick fix: bump the cache ceiling and restart the render workers, then find the offending plugin via the retention report. Plugin authors: please release handles in onEvict, not onUnload — the latter fires too late. To apply the mitigation, restart each worker with the cache overrides shown below.

service settings:
druael:
  log_level: debug
  metrics_host: metrics.druael.zemvarlabs.internal
  pool_size: 16

## Partner SFTP Drop — Ferngate Exchange

Plugin authors delivering builds to the Ferngate partner drop should upload to the staging directory only; the ingest job moves validated files nightly. File names must follow the versioned naming scheme described in the plugin guide, and archives over 2 GB should be split. Access is key-based only; password logins are disabled. Add the following deploy key to your account before your first upload.

signing key of bagap-yawep = bky13_TbfT6ZMUoGJo2

**Ticket PS-118: spooler env mixed up again**

Hey on-call — the `quillpress-spooler` service in the Harbortown cluster is pointing at the staging print queue instead of prod, so jobs are silently vanishing. Looks like someone copied the wrong env template during Friday's redeploy. Flip `QUEUE_REGION` back to `harbortown-prod`, then add the broker credential on the next line:

sealed setting: VAULT_KEY20=c8ea1e419912889df6b4